Transaction 064c37886008fc52d0d7bc1765ca13a2227b894c4a27bf6c11833db679d12ef1

1 Input
2 Outputs
  • 064c37886008fc52d0d7bc1765ca13a2227b894c4a27bf6c11833db679d12ef1:0
  • value  20700000
    address  16KGLAEmoufKtsKAkbUD3zX3FVSHpyxi2x
  • 064c37886008fc52d0d7bc1765ca13a2227b894c4a27bf6c11833db679d12ef1:1
  • value  379309288
    address  1PBgMnHNXhQhntGVJ7SwrYooNMppowdEck